    SAP Error Message:
    WG361 Supplier service level &3 % for supplier &1, plant &2 <= &4 %
    
    Meaning / 
    Cause: This message indicates that the supplier's service level for a particular supplier (&1) and plant (&2) is less than or equal to a specified threshold (&4 %). The service level is currently at &3 %, which is below or equal to the minimum acceptable service level. Supplier service level is a key performance indicator that measures the reliability and timeliness of a supplier's deliveries. The system is warning or blocking a process because the supplier's service level is too low, which could impact procurement, production, or inventory planning. Typical Causes: The supplier has a history of late or incomplete deliveries. The service level threshold is set too high for the supplier's current performance.
